Hi QuestionMaster,

***Please do not reboot until it is requested. Rebooting during this process will cause reinfection!***

Run HijackThis again and place a check beside each of the following items. Once done click the fix checked button.

O2 - BHO: (no name) - {B7F35449-8C64-46FE-04C7-7E957F18AF3F} - C:\WINDOWS\system32\nttp.dll
O4 - HKLM\..\Run: [d3fo32.exe] C:\WINDOWS\system32\d3fo32.exe
O4 - HKLM\..\Run: [wined32.exe] C:\WINDOWS\wined32.exe


Next, hold down the Ctrl+Shift keys on your keyboard and tap the Esc key. This will open task manager. End each of the following processes by selecting it and pressing the End Process button and clicking Yes to the confirmation message:

d3fo32.exe
wined32.exe


Download about:Buster
http://tools.zerosrealm.com/AboutBuster.zip

Run AboutBuster.exe and click ok and then start. Paste this exact line into the text box in about:Buster:

res://C:\WINDOWS\zqdla.dll/sp.html#37049

Make sure you have printed this page and close ALL Internet Explorer windows. This is a very important step!!

Next click Ok and allow the program to run. After it runs copy its report and paste it back into this thread.

Next, go to c:\documents and Settings\{username}\local settings\Temp and delete all files in that temp folder.

Reboot and post a new HijackThis log along with the report from about:Buster if there were any errors in it.
